We are seeking an Executive Underwriter to join our National Private Equity Practice for our Financial Lines / Private and Not-for-Profit Insurance Products. The PNP Underwriter will be accountable for the growth and profitability of private equity-backed accounts for the Midwest Region. This position is salary grade flexible based on the successful candidate's experience.
Personal Book of Business: 
- Financial performance, including profit, rate, retention, and growth, of a personal book of business consisting of D&O, EPL, Fiduciary, Employed Lawyers, Crime, K&R/Extortion, and Workplace Violence lines of business.
 - Successful market penetration and agency management including building, maintaining and managing producer and customer relationships
 - Developing personal agency strategy and goals with continual monitoring of progress
 - Identifying cross sell opportunities within commercial products and services on personal book of business
 - Soliciting, selecting and analyzing risk within PNP guidelines and ensuring proper documentation
 - Developing and negotiating price, coverage, and terms and conditions for all new business and renewals and actively identifying account rounding opportunities
 - Meeting with producers and renewal customers to make sales presentations including product education and new product roll out
 - Collaborating with underwriters, operations, claims, marketing and home office product management
 - Consistently meeting service standards
 - Collecting and sharing industry intelligence with team, including industry trending and development
